    not the healthiest thing ever, but:

    Tamale casserole
    1 tube of polenta (I usually use about 4/5, but have some left over)
    1 can la preferida low fat refried black beans
    1lb laura's lean beef, browned (92/8)
    1 can red enchilada sauce (low fat)
    1/2 cup 2% shredded cheese (I use 4-cheese Mexican blend)

    line bottom of 8x8 or 9x9 pan with 1/2 inch polenta rounds, top with half of the enchilada sauce, layer all of the refried beans, all of the beef, then top with the remaining enchilada sauce and cheese. bake till heated through

    4 servings
    453 calories
    47g carbs
    14g fat
    34g protein
    7g fiber

    Low sugar smokey orange chicken over sticky rice! It's so yummy- chicken breasts baked in a mixture of SF orange marmalade, soy sauce, red chilie flakes, minced garlic and liquid smoke in the oven for 30 minutes at 400. High protien, low-cal. Love it!
